Civic woes of residents of Dibrugarh town

From a Correspondent

Dibrugarh, Jan 5: Dibrugarh Municipal Board once again finds itself on a sticky wicket as some serious accusations have been levied against the body by the residents. The body has been accused of being negligent to the timely and systematic cleaning of many drains in the town.  This casual attitude has become all the more apparent in its handling of the drain in G lane of the Milan gar area. Although the cleaning work started around three months back, it was left in an incomplete manner. Moreover, the soil dug out from the drain has been lying on the roadside, causing major inconvenience to the commuters. Moreover, the locals have also been demanding for a dustbin to the east of the G lane, but to no avail.

Additiolly, the drains located underneath the footpaths on either side of the RKB path have also not been cleaned despite the fact that the same irresponsible behaviour had led to the overflowing of the drains during last year’s monsoon rainfall.
